a couple of suggestions though:
its worth considering adding the gui package to ubuntu - it can make it a lot easier to configure things when necessary (i struggled to get wavin running to add a line-in signal to my LMS for my DAB radio
add a rdp package so you can remote desktop into it from a windows pc, then you dont need to physically go to the server to administer it (assuming you are windows, not mac)
once you got it up and running and configured, use an external drive and bootable backup usb stick to take an image of the hard drive - occasionally you will break it and its a whole lot eaier to restore an image back to a good up and running system rather than having to reinstall everything again
